Michelle I. Lehner passed away March 2, 2014 in Mesa, Arizona. Michelle was born April 24, 1956 in Billings, Montana to Bryan and Marjorie Ballard. She attended schools in the Billings area. She was an excellent pool player, which very few people knew. She had an extreme love of dogs and she knew all dog breeds. She loved humming birds and always kept humming bird feeders filled with her magic potion, which at times attracted dozens of birds. She loved her two golden retrievers, even loved her daughter’s dog.
She was always full of humor and total devotion to the good things in life. Michelle often talked about riding her horse as a kid. She was a horse fan.
Cooking was one of her favorite things to do at home. She tried anything and it was always good. Holidays with family were always special with her. She loved having the entire family over.
She had Bunco parties every month with all the women getting together to eat, drink and play. She loved doing these parties.
Michelle is preceded in death by her mother, father and brother, Bobby. Michelle is survived by her husband, Doug; daughter, Brittney; and son Brandon and his wife, Kathy; also, 3 grandchildren, Bryan, Avery and Jaclynn, 3 sisters, Kathy, Diane, and Susie and a brother, Rick, and numerous nieces and nephews.
